On your turn, you will take the hammer and tap along any side of the box.
The first player to fill four wagon cards with gems wins the game. Hammer Time is a game about knocking gems off a box with a hammer. Each player shuffles their wagon cards and flips one face up. There are two types of cards in the game: task cards (which can provide a bonus gem) and wagon cards (each player has four).įinally, there’s a color die used for the Master variant of the game. It’s no surprise the chunky wooden hammer is the star of the show. You will permanently attach this to the box bottom. There’s a large mousepad-like sticker illustrated with cavern walls and Dragomir the Dragon sleeping in the corner. The game board is very unconventional it’s the bottom of the box turned over, so it forms a mini-table. 90 brightly colored gemstones in 6 different colors will be strewn across the game board.
